On January 10, 2022 at 08:36 UTC, a magnitude 5.6 shallow crustal earthquake struck 23 km NW of Trancas, Argentina, at a depth of 8.0 km and coordinates -26.0798°, -65.4393°. The earthquake was reported felt by 36 peopleacross nearby locations, with a maximum shaking intensity of Modified Mercalli Intensity (MMI) 6.7 (very strong). The USGS PAGER system issued a green alert level for this event, indicating no significant casualties or damage expected. The nearest populated place is Trancas (population 6,658).

Physical scale: An earthquake of magnitude 5.6 releases seismic energy equivalent to roughly 4 kilotons of TNT. Empirical fault-scaling laws (Wells & Coppersmith, 1994) estimate the subsurface rupture length at approximately 4.4 km — a useful intuition for the size of the slip patch on the fault.
